A high-fill factor/high-SNR CMOS readout integrated circuit (ROIC) array is designed for high dynamic range infrared
imaging systems. The designed ROIC array uses a single reference photodiode that is routed to each unit cell in the array
to subtract the dark current for high SNR and high fill factor. The achieved average SNR is 80 dB and the fill factor is
28% with a 25 x 25 μm2 unit cell size. With this new unit cell and routing approach, the size of the unit cell is reduced by
300% compared to other high SNR circuits. The maximum power consumption per unit pixel is 500nW.
